+/*!
+  Validates the given string against an email address pattern.
+*/
+bool NmUtilities::isValidEmailAddress( const QString &emailAddress )
+{
+    return EmailAddressPattern.exactMatch(emailAddress);
+}
+
+/*!
+  Generates a display string from an NmAddress object.
+*/
+QString NmUtilities::addressToDisplayName( const NmAddress &address )
+{
+    QString emailAddress = address.address();
+    QString displayName = address.displayName();
+
+    QString ret;
+    if (displayName.length() > 0 && displayName != emailAddress) {
+        ret = displayName + " <" + emailAddress + ">";
+    }
+    else {
+        ret = emailAddress;
+    }
+    return ret;
+}
+
+/*!
+  Returns an NmAddress object that is parsed from a display name string.
+*/
+bool NmUtilities::parseEmailAddress( const QString &emailAddress, NmAddress &address )
+{
+    bool foundAddress = false;
+
+    QRegExp rx(EmailAddressPattern);
+    // locate the email address in the string
+    int pos = rx.indexIn(emailAddress);
+    if (pos != -1) {
+        // extract the email address...
+        int matchedLen = rx.matchedLength();
+        QString addr = emailAddress.mid(pos, matchedLen);
+        address.setAddress(addr);
+
+        // ...and use the rest as display name
+        QString name = emailAddress.left(pos) + emailAddress.mid(pos + matchedLen);
+        address.setDisplayName(cleanupDisplayName(name));
+
+        foundAddress = true;
+    }
+
+    return foundAddress;
+}
+
+/*!
+  Cleans up display name by stripping extra characters from the beginning and end of the string.
+*/
+QString NmUtilities::cleanupDisplayName( const QString &displayName )
+{
+    // find the first and last position that is NOT one of the characters below
+    QRegExp rx("[^\\s\"<>]");
+    int firstPos = std::max(rx.indexIn(displayName), 0);
+    int lastPos = rx.lastIndexIn(displayName);
+
+    if (lastPos < 0) {
+        lastPos = displayName.length() - 1;
+    }
+
+    return displayName.mid(firstPos, lastPos - firstPos + 1);
+}
